Which Winch – hydraulic or electric?

Winches can be powered in a variety of different ways, including hydraulic and electric power.  Choosing the right winch will be based on review of several factors.  When choosing between hydraulic and electric winches, ask these questions:

What will power the winch?
How will the winch be used?
How tough is the job?
How long will the winch need to perform work?

Power Source
An electric winch typically uses the battery of a vehicle in order to power the winch’s motor. It will only work if the vehicle battery is charged, and it is possible for an electric winch to drain a battery quickly.  Electric winches are the right choice for quick, occasional, and light use, as in ATV recovery, as they do not require as much in the way of power.

A hydraulic winch is powered by a hydraulic system.  A hydraulic pump is required to operate the winch, but the efficiency of a hydraulic winch, however, is unmatched in power and durability.  A hydraulic winch is built to withstand a big job, with the power to handle it effectively.

On the Job
One of the main advantages of an electric winch is that it is often easier to install.  If there is a need to transfer the winch from one vehicle to another, one must simply reinstall only the winch. ATV enthusiasts will appreciate an electric winch more, because it can be fast and efficient, and has enough power to pull them out of a rut.  As it is only run on the battery of the vehicle, it does not require the expense of installing the hydraulic pump to power it.

Most any other big job is going to require a hydraulic winch, offering heavy duty capability and raw durability.  The installation of a hydraulic winch will require more components to power it, but you cannot put a price on the efficiency and strength gained.  For instance, a tow truck would require a hydraulic winch, but would also utilize a built in hydraulic pump system to power the heavy duty winch.

The Legendary M8274 WARN Winch

They say legends never die, and this is true of the timeless quality of the WARN M8274 winch. Born in 1974, it was built to last, and is still in production today.  This speaks volumes about the innovative design and durability of this rugged winch. This winch is likely the most recognized and best-known truly heavy duty winch made by WARN Industries.

History
WARN Industries has been creating quality and innovative winch products since 1948. The WARN M8274 originally replaced the WARN Belleview winch that was made from 1959-1973. The M8274 has remained virtually unchanged since 1974, with only some improvements such as upgraded electrics and some cosmetic revisions over the years.  In 1998, in honor of WARN Industries’ 50th anniversary, the winch became known as the M8274-50, and some more slight cosmetic changes were made. A limited edition M8274-60 was offered in honor of the company’s 60th anniversary in 2008, each individually numbered, and equipped with synthetic rope, painted black and shipped in a wooden crate.

Identification
The model number identification system is smart and easy to cipher.  The “M” stands for model, “8” is for its 8,000lbs. capacity, “2” for two-way free spool and power in, and “74” for the year it was introduced.

As this incredible heavy duty winch has been around for over 40 years, there are many of them still working at top performance levels in regular recovery duty. Identifying M2874 winches built before the 1990s can be done by using a 3-digit number found on the upper housing of the winch.  The first number represents the month it was made.  For example, A=1 B=2 C=3 and so on.  “A” would represent the first month, so it would be January.

The second letter stands for the working of the day of the month, not including Saturdays or Sundays.  If the second letter were a “B” it would be the second working day of the month.

The ending number will represent the year the winch was made during the 70s or 80s, as WARN Industries began using serial numbers after the 1990s.  For example, if the number is a “6”, then the winch would have been built in 1976 or 1986.  Beginning in about 1980, WARN switched from a metal socket on the control pack to a plastic socket.  This will help to further distinguish which decade the winch was manufactured.

If the 3-digit number found on the upper housing were represented as FB6, the winch would have been manufactured on the second working day of June, in 1976 or 1986, depending on the socket on the control pack.

Today’s M8274-50
The M8274-50 has captured the fancy of off-roaders who compete, because it is WARN’s fastest heavy duty winch.  This winch’s no-load retrieval speed is 79.3 feet per minute, and includes 150ft of 5/16” cable, enabling a long line capacity. It is so good, it is part of WARN’s Premium Winch Series.

The M8274-50 has a smooth braking system with superior heat dissipation.  It includes a roller fairlead, remote control on 12-ft. lead, free spool clutch and battery cables.

“The Wrap” on Wire Rope Spooling

As winching has evolved and improvements made, the industry gets stronger and is able to meet more challenges.  However, something as simple as improper rope spooling can shut down a job. Here you will find the facts you need to keep your winch rolling.

The development of wire rope for winching was revolutionary, but it comes with some technical challenges that users must be aware of for safe and efficient winch use.  One issue that can arise is a problem with the way the rope wraps around the drum.  You can usually figure out pretty quickly what your problem is, based on the way the rope is spooling.

Rope Spooling in Center – a possible cause for this may be because the distance between the winch and the first sheave is too short.  This may mean that the fleet angle needs to be adjusted.

Uneven Spooling – This could mean that the wire rope lay is not correct or the load on the winch is too light for the amount of pull.  The first layer of wire rope installed on the winch drum may not be correct.  Simply readjusting the first layer line would probably take care of the issue.

Rope Climbs Flange Side – If the hoist is not mounted perpendicular with the first sheave, or the center of the winch drum is not aligned with the first sheave, the wire rope may climb on side of the flange, and not wrap evenly.    This can also occur if the drum flanges are not straight.

If the wire rope is climbing both flanges, the distance between the winch drum and the first sheave is too great.

Rope Knives Into Lower Layers – Possible causes could be the lower wire rope layers not installed properly due to a light load, a grooved winch drum, or the groove and wire rope sizes are mismatched.

Secure Winch Mounting Tips

jeeptrucksuv

When installing a winch, secure winch mounting is of the utmost importance.  This ensures the protection of your winch, and more importantly, the user.

Depending on your winch use, there are specific installation requirements for each winch.  Generally though, the following guidelines should be implemented:wrecker

  1. The mount must be flat to ensure proper alignment between the gearbox side, the drum, and the clutch.
  2. A rule of thumb to use when selecting capscrews to mount the winch, is to use the same size number of capscrews to fasten the winch to its mount as are used to fasten the gearbox and end bracket to the winch frames.
  3. All capscrews used to mount the winch MATERIAL-HANDLINGashould be Grade 5 or better and should be carefully tightened to the proper torque value for their size.
  4. The mounting span of the winch is very important.
  5. Make sure that the hydraulic system is clean and that all components function properly, especially valve relief.

Understanding and Choosing a Hydraulic System Design

Proper selection and installation of all hydraulic components in your winch system will mean the difference between a winch system which performs as it should and one which causes constant maintenance problems and poor performance.   Understanding basic function, design and components helps ensure proper selection and optimum usage for any hydraulic winch application.

The basic concept of any hydraulic system is simple: Force that is applied at one point is transmitted to another point using an incompressible fluid, yet every hydraulic system design will be unique to the application.  A few hydraulic system components will be common for winch usage, such as pump/power take-offs and directional control valves.

The following component information is general in nature, and will be helpful in choosing a hydraulic system design for a winch.  It is always wise to consult a qualified hydraulic distributor, like Winches Inc, if you have specific questions about your system.

Pump/Power Take-Offs

The hydraulic pump and PTO selected should be chosen to deliver the proper flow at any engine speed you want to run.  For example, with an engine running at 1200 RPM, using a PTO which runs at 70% engine speed, a winch requiring 18 GPM flow for the line speed needed, the pump selected must be capable of delivering 18 GPM at 840 RPM, as that is what the PTO requires to operate.  Also, the pump must be pressure rated for at least the setting of the relief valve.

Another important consideration on pump selection is to select the proper rotation.  Most pumps are not bi-rotational; that is, they will function properly only in one direction of rotation.  For example, if a PTO provides engine-wise rotation and the pump is mounted behind it with the shaft toward the front, a “right hand” or clockwise rotation of the pump is required.  Other directions of mounting either the pump or PTO will affect the direction of rotation, so they must be considered in your selection.

Directional Control Valves

The typical directional control valve to be used with a winch is a three position, four-way valve with an open center spool which is spring returned in neutral.  The open center spool is often referred to as a “motor” spool, since its most common function is providing flow to hydraulic motors. In most winch applications, the spool should be spring returned to neutral, since this serves as a safety feature.  As soon as the operator’s hand is removed from the valve lever the winch will stop running.

BRADEN CH SERIES, THE INDUSTRY STANDARD  

BRADEN Winch introduced its first CH Series planetary hoisting winch to the offshore industry more than four decades ago.  Since then, the CH series design has under gone two major design changes, improving its performance and longevity.  The key features of the current third generation CH Series planetary hoisting winches includes:

  • A robust ball-bearing, overrunning clutch, allowing increased input speed and superior fall back protection.
  • A super durable, time tested, spring applied, hydraulically released internal brake, designed to give years of consistent braking.
  • A highly efficient, superior quality planetary gearing system for maximum efficiency and a long service life.

The CH Series offers line pull ratings from 6 tons to 30 tons, but the true value of the powerful BRADEN CH series is in the application flexibility, breadth of the product line and the optional features to tailor the winch to meet specific requirements.  Below is a list of some of the many options and accessories available to enhance the BRADEN CH Series.

RollerandgrooveddrumGrooved Cable Drum
BRADEN offers some CH Series models with grooving cast into the cable drum.  On all other models, grooving can be added by installing a sleeve over the standard smooth cable drum.  The grooving on a cable drum supports proper spooling of the first layer of wire rope on the cable drum.  A proper first layer is a key factor to ensure all other layer spool correctly.  In applications when the bulk of the winch work is done of the first layer, grooving is a must

Tension Roller
Each CH Series winch can be equipped with a tension roller to assist with proper spooling of the wire rope on the cable drum.  The primary function of a tension roller, also known as a pressure roller, is to keep constant pressure on the wire rope as it spools onto the cable drum.  The constant pressure enhances spooling, especially when the wire rope is in a slack condition.  Improved spooling increases the life of the wire rope, saving time and money.

auxiularybrakeAuxiliary Brake
All CH Series models are available with an auxiliary brake.  The BRADEN auxiliary brake is a fully enclosed, spring applied, hydraulically released friction brake acting directly on the drum.  The sole function of this third redundant brake is to provide a means to stop a load, should the counter balance valve and internal brake fail.

dualmotorsDual Hydraulic Motor Input
As drill rigs move further offshore, the winches are required to hoist for longer distances.  BRADEN has released dual motor inputs on some of the larger CH Series winches.  Dual motors provide additional torque for high load requirement but also allow for greater line speeds.  Faster line speed increases efficiency as load get from boat to rig much faster.


Rotation Indicators
Most models can be equipped with rotation indicators and/or last rap indicators.  On large cranes the winch is often not visible to the operator.  Both rotation and last wrap indication are good methods to give the operator feedback on the current state of the winch.  BRADEN has even offered a speed sensor, providing the operator with a positive vibration signal in the control joystick.  The faster the winch line speed the faster the vibration felt in the control joystick.

 Gear and Piston Motors
One of the simplest, most effective ways to increase the efficiency of a CH Series hoisting winch is to take some time to select the correct hydraulic motor.  Different types of motor produce different results in the performance of your winch.  Braden offers a wide selection of gear motors, gerotor motors and piston motors to tailor the performance of the winch to the specifics of any hydraulic system and application requirements.
